Tengu is a USB-powered chap that lights up and lip-syncs to music, or your voice, or whatever noise happens to be around at the time. Tengu has different facial expressions that can be matched to different music.
For instance, he can frown when someone plays a Girls Aloud track. Just like the rest of us. When there's no sound to be heard, he'll simply fall asleep, but as soon as he detects some noise he'll wake up again. Tengu is a little like your mate that likes karaoke, except that he's not a) irritating, or b) a habitual drunk. He's guaranteed to raise a smile as he mimes along to Enter Sandman by Metallica.
Tengu is a stand-alone device that doesn't require any additional software on the host computer. To change Tengu’s facial expressions you just need to blow on his face for a second (his face will change automatically if he hears a lot of loud music).
Tengu responds to different sound levels and with the right music he magically lip-syncs with the vocal. We don't know what witchcraft is behind it all, but we damn sure like it.
